Single-Point Visibility Constraint Minimum Link Paths in Simple Polygons
We address the following problem: Given a simple polygon $P$ with $n$ vertices and two points $s$ and $t$ inside it, find a minimum link path between them such that a given target point $q$ is visible from at least one point on the path. متن کاملCLUSTER CATEGORIES, m-CLUSTER CATEGORIES AND DIAGONALS IN POLYGONS
The goals of this expository article are on one hand to describe how to construct (m-) cluster categories from triangulations (resp. from m+2angulations) of polygons. On the other hand, we explain how to use translation quivers and their powers to obtain the m-cluster categories directly from the diagonals of a polygon.
متن کاملOn polygons enclosing point sets
Let R and B be disjoint point sets such that R ∪ B is in general position. We say that B is enclosed by R if there is a simple polygon P with vertex set R such that all the elements in B belong to the interior of P . This paper presents a framework for reasoning about robust geoemtric algorithms. Robustness is formally deened and a data structure called an approximate polygon is introduced and used to reason about polygons constructed of edges whose positions are uncertain.
